Mussels steamed with white wine, celery, and herbs, served with fries. A Belgian classic widely enjoyed in Bruges.
Traditional Flemish beef stew slowly cooked with Belgian dark beer, often slightly sweet and deeply rich.
A creamy Belgian stew, usually made with chicken or fish and vegetables. It is a comforting regional specialty.

Bruges is pricier than many Belgian cities, especially in the historic center. Hotels and tourist restaurants cost more, but bakeries and lunch deals help.
Service is usually included. Tipping is not required, but rounding up or leaving 5-10% for great service is appreciated. Round up taxis; small tips are optional in cafes and bars.

The ticket office is open Mon - Fri: 05:45 - 21:30, Sat - Sun: 06:00 - 21:30. Information desks are located inside the corridor leading away from the platforms and towards the central exit.
Luggage storage is luggage lockers are located near the entrance inside the main station.
Available at Brugge: Parking, Taxis, WC.
Available at Brugge: Bike Parking, Bike Rental.
Accessibility facilities are available at Brugge: Facilities include elevators and escalators to platforms, wheelchair lifts and mobile ramps, barrier-free toilets and accessible parking spaces. Additional assistance can be contacted via the SNCB Mobility Call Center.
